The most effective way to expand your vocabulary is to say a new word out loud to commit it to memory when you encounter it. car

ry a dictionary with you so you can look up unfamiliar words. write down new words and their meanings so you can look them up when you need them. use the words you've learned regularly when you write and speak.
English
1 answer:
11Alexandr11 [23.1K]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

use the words you've learned regularly when you write and speak.

Explanation:

Vocabulary is simply the word stock that a person uses frequently.

There are many effective ways of expanding one's vocabulary which are writing down new words and looking up their meanings, reading new material, etc but the most effective way to expand vocabulary is to use the words you've learned regularly when you write and speak because this is the surest way to make sure that those words you learned become your core languages.
